Introduction
AI can write, paint, and chat like a human. But it does not think. It calculates. This dazzles us, yet we forget: intelligence is not the same as understanding.
Body
AI finds patterns in massive data. It translates languages, detects cancers, and drives cars. But it has no consciousness, no emotions, no common sense. It cannot feel joy or regret. It mimics, but never comprehends. It solves problems it was trained for, yet fails at anything outside that box.
Conclusion
AI is a powerful tool, not a thinking being. We should use its speed, but trust our own wisdom. The future belongs not to machines, but to humans who know how to guide them.
